Tomography of entangling two-qubit logic operations in exchange-coupled donor electron spin qubits
<p>Scalable quantum processors require high-fidelity universal quantum logic operations in a manufacturable physical platform. Donors in silicon provide atomic size, excellent quantum coherence and compatibility with standard semiconductor processing, but no entanglement between donor-bound electron spins has been demonstrated to date. Here we present the experimental demonstration and tomography of universal 1- and 2-qubit gates in a system of two weakly exchange-coupled electrons, bound to single phosphorus donors introduced in silicon by ion implantation. We surprisingly observe that the exchange interaction has no effect on the qubit coherence. We quantify the fidelity of the quantum operations using gate set tomography (GST), and we use the universal gate set to create entangled Bell states of the electrons spins, with fidelity ≈ 93%, and concurrence 0.91 ± 0.08. These results form the necessary basis for scaling up donor-based quantum computers.</p>

Data from: Repeatable, continuous and real-time estimates of coupled nitrogenase activity and carbon exchange at the whole-plant scale
1. Symbiotic nitrogen fixation (SNF) by higher plants and their bacterial symbionts is a globally important input of nitrogen. Our understanding of the mechanisms that control SNF and the timescales over which they operate has been constrained by limitations of the existing methods for measuring SNF. One method, Acetylene Reduction Assays by Cavity-ring down laser Absorption Spectroscopy (ARACAS), seems promising, as it is highly sensitive and gives rapid, continuous, repeatable and real-time measurements of nitrogenase activity. ARACAS has been used to study nitrogen fixation in lichens, mosses and asymbiotic bacteria, but adapting it to higher plants poses challenges because acetylene and ethylene can influence plant function. 2. Here we report modifications to ARACAS that allow it to be used on higher plants in an environmentally-controlled incubation chamber. The modifications include lower concentrations of acetylene (2%) and ethylene and concurrent measurements of whole chamber CO2 exchange, H2O exchange and nitrogenase activity, linking nitrogenase activity to whole-plant rates of photosynthesis and respiration. 3. After propagating the error terms from all sources, we establish the following parameters of the method: (A) The detection limit of our method was 2-3 ppbv C2H4 hr-1, although it rose substantially when we used tank-derived acetylene, which has much higher ethylene contamination; (B) Repeated measures at a frequency of 3 days or longer did not diminish nitrogenase activity or photosynthesis, although daily measurements diminished nitrogenase activity; (C) This method can detect changes at timescales as short as seconds; (D) Continuous measurement of nitrogenase activity is maintained above 90% of the maximum rate for 7.0 ± 1.3 (mean ± SD) hours. 4. This method has the potential to improve our understanding of the controls over SNF and therefore how SNF and global nitrogen and carbon cycling are likely to be affected by global change.

Data from: In silico study of the role of cell growth factors in photosynthesis using a virtual leaf tissue generator coupled to a microscale photosynthesis gas exchange model
Computational tools that allow in silico analysis of the role of cell growth and division on photosynthesis are scarce. We present a freely available tool that combines a virtual leaf tissue generator and a two-dimensional microscale model of gas transport during C3 photosynthesis. A total of 270 mesophyll geometries were generated with varying degree of growth anisotropy, growth extent and extent of schizogenous airspace formation in the palisade mesophyll. The anatomical properties of the virtual leaf tissue and microscopic cross sections of actual leaf tissue of tomato (Solanum lycopersicum L.) were statistically compared. Model equations for transport of CO2 in the liquid phase of the leaf tissue were discretized over the geometries. The virtual leaf tissue generator produced a leaf anatomy of tomato that was statistically similar to real tomato leaf tissue. The response of photosynthesis to intercellular CO2 predicted by a model that used the virtual leaf tissue geometry compared well with measured values. The results indicate that the light-saturated rate of photosynthesis was influenced by interactive effects of extent and directionality of cell growth and degree of airspace formation through the exposed surface of mesophyll per leaf area. The tool could be used further in investigations of improving photosynthesis and gas exchange in relation to cell growth and leaf anatomy.
